Chocolate Pudding Brownie Bars

  1. Prepare the pudding according to package directions using the 2 cups half and half or whole milk.
  2. Remove pudding from the heat, and stir in 1/2 of the package of chocolate chips; stir to melt chips.
  3. Cover and refrigerate the pudding for 3-4 hours.
  4. Set oven to 350 degrees.
  5. Grease a 13 x 9-inch baking pan.
  6. In a bowl, combine/beat the sugar and softened butter.
  7. Add in the eggs and vanilla; mix well.
  8. In a bowl sift together flour, baking powder and cocoa.
  9. Add to the creamed mixture; mix well.
  10. Stir in remaining chocolate chips and nuts (if using); mix to combine.
  11. Spread batter into prepared baking pan.
  12. Bake for 20-25 minutes, or until done; cool.
  13. Remove pudding from the fridge; stir gently to mix.
  14. Spread on top of cooled brownies in the pan.
  15. Sprinkle chocolate shavings on top if desired.
  16. Serve topped with ice cream or Cool Whip topping.
